IT Manager, Healthcare IT & HIPAA Compliance
Overview
Own and lead day-to-day IT operations across a multi-location healthcare platform supporting clinical and administrative teams. Drive secure infrastructure, regulatory compliance, vendor relationships, and EHR support while enabling scalable technology solutions for patient care. Collaborate with leadership to align technology strategy with operational goals and growth.
What You'll Do5
- 1Build and maintain network infrastructure, workstations, and mobile devices to ensure 99.9% uptime across locations
- 2Design and enforce cybersecurity program including endpoint protection, MFA, backups, and incident response aligned with NIST CSF
- 3Oversee EHR and practice management system support, rollout, and migrations including automation tools
- 4Manage MSPs and vendors, monitor SLAs, contracts, renewals, and technology budgets
- 5Scale IT operations with documentation, disaster recovery plans, and training materials for staff
Requirements5
- 15+ years of IT management or senior systems administration experience
- 2Experience supporting multi-location organizations and remote clinical staff
- 3Healthcare IT experience and familiarity with HIPAA compliance
- 4Strong knowledge of Microsoft 365 administration including Entra ID, Intune, Defender
- 5Experience with network security, firewalls, VPNs, backups, and disaster recovery
